4月10日消息传来,全球科技巨头谷歌公司再度刷新AI技术的新高度,正式发布了CodeGemma先进大语言模型(LLMs)。这款模型专门用于生成代码、理解和追踪指令等任务,旨在为全球开发人员提供更加便捷、高效的代码辅助工具,引领新一轮的编程智能革命。
CodeGemma作为Gemma模型开放访问系列的重要组成部分,其开发团队针对代码开发场景进行了深度优化和微调,以确保模型能够精准地满足开发者的需求。该套件不仅包括了基础的代码补全和生成功能,还整合了自然语言处理的能力,让代码与语言的交互更加自然流畅。
据了解,CodeGemma系列包括了三种不同的模型,每种模型都拥有独特的参数配置和功能特点。首先是20亿参数的基础模型,该模型主要优化了代码补全和生成功能,在注重延迟和隐私的前提下,为开发者提供快速且高效的代码解决方案。其次,70亿参数基础模型则进一步整合了代码补全和自然语言处理的能力,使得模型在完成代码任务时更加实用,同时也能够更好地理解并生成自然语言。
值得一提的是,CodeGemma系列中还有一款专门用于指导追踪的70亿参数模型。这款模型能够参与关于代码、编程和数学推理的对话,为开发者在寻求指导或注释时提供宝贵的资源。无论是新手还是资深开发者,都能从中受益,提升编程效率和代码质量。
AI旋风了解到,CodeGemma的上述三个模型均利用了预先训练的Gemma检查点,并在此基础上进行了大量的训练。模型训练过程中涵盖了英语、数学以及各种编码语言的另外5000亿个词块,使其在逻辑和数学推理方面展现出超凡的能力。这一特点为代码生成和完成树立了新的标杆,让CodeGemma在同类产品中脱颖而出。
在实际应用中,70亿参数模型在Python、Java、JavaScript和C++等多种编程语言中均表现出色。根据官方发布的数据,该模型在HumanEval和MultiPL-E基准测试中取得了优异的成绩,充分证明了其在代码生成和完成方面的强大能力。此外,在GSM8K评估中名列前茅的表现也进一步验证了CodeGemma模型的多功能性和有效性。
CodeGemma的发布无疑为开发者们带来了一股强大的助力。它不仅能够提高开发者的编程效率,降低出错率,还能在一定程度上减轻开发者的工作负担,让他们有更多精力投入到创新和优化上。对于谷歌而言,CodeGemma的推出也是其在AI领域持续创新、深化布局的重要体现。
随着人工智能技术的不断发展,AI代码辅助工具已经成为开发者们不可或缺的一部分。CodeGemma的发布,无疑将进一步推动代码辅助工具的发展,为开发者们带来更加智能、高效的编程体验。同时,这也预示着AI技术在编程领域的应用将越来越广泛,未来的编程世界将更加智能化、自动化。